Eco-Friendly Laundry: The Environmental Benefits Of Line Drying Clothes

is line drying good for environment

Line drying clothes is increasingly recognized as an environmentally friendly alternative to using electric dryers. By harnessing natural energy from the sun and wind, line drying reduces reliance on electricity, thereby lowering carbon emissions and decreasing energy consumption. This method also extends the lifespan of garments by avoiding the wear and tear caused by mechanical drying, reducing the need for frequent replacements and minimizing textile waste. Additionally, line drying eliminates the use of dryer sheets and fabric softeners, which often contain harmful chemicals that can pollute water systems. While it may require more time and effort, line drying offers a simple yet effective way to reduce one’s environmental footprint and contribute to a more sustainable lifestyle.

Reduced Energy Consumption: Line drying saves electricity, lowering carbon emissions from power plants

Line drying clothes is a simple yet powerful way to reduce your carbon footprint. By opting for the sun and wind over a mechanical dryer, you directly cut down on electricity use. The average electric dryer consumes between 1,800 and 5,000 watts per cycle, depending on its size and efficiency. Over a year, this translates to roughly 600 to 1,500 kilowatt-hours (kWh) of electricity for a household that dries laundry regularly. Line drying eliminates this energy demand entirely, offering a tangible way to lower your household’s energy consumption.

Consider the broader environmental impact of this shift. Power plants, which generate the electricity needed to run dryers, are major sources of carbon emissions. In the U.S., the electricity sector accounts for about 25% of total greenhouse gas emissions. By line drying, you reduce the strain on the grid, indirectly lowering the amount of fossil fuels burned to meet energy demands. For instance, skipping just one dryer cycle per week could save approximately 150 kWh annually, equivalent to avoiding the emission of 100 kilograms of CO₂—roughly the same as driving a car for 250 miles.

Practical implementation is key to maximizing these benefits. Start by designating a sunny, well-ventilated outdoor space for drying, or use a foldable rack indoors if weather is an issue. For best results, shake out garments before hanging to reduce wrinkles, and rotate thicker items like towels periodically to ensure even drying. Pair line drying with energy-efficient washing habits, such as using cold water and full loads, to amplify your environmental impact. Small changes in routine can lead to significant long-term savings for both your wallet and the planet.

Longer Clothing Lifespan: Air drying prevents fabric wear, reducing waste and resource use

Air drying clothes isn't just a nostalgic practice; it's a powerful tool for extending the lifespan of your garments. The tumbling action of a dryer, while convenient, subjects fabrics to heat and friction, breaking down fibers over time. This leads to fading, pilling, and eventual thinning, sending once-loved pieces to the landfill prematurely.

Imagine your favorite cotton t-shirt, its vibrant color muted and its once-soft texture rough after countless dryer cycles. Air drying, on the other hand, is a gentler approach. It allows fabrics to retain their shape, color, and integrity for significantly longer.

The environmental benefits are twofold. Firstly, by prolonging the life of your clothes, you directly reduce the demand for new garments. The fashion industry is a major contributor to pollution and resource depletion, from water-intensive cotton farming to the energy-guzzling production processes. Extending the lifespan of existing clothes means fewer resources are needed to create new ones.

No Chemical Usage: Avoids dryer sheets and fabric softeners, minimizing chemical pollution

Line drying eliminates the need for dryer sheets and liquid fabric softeners, products notorious for their chemical cocktails. These items often contain quaternary ammonium compounds (quats), fragrances, and other additives linked to skin irritation, respiratory issues, and environmental harm. By skipping them entirely, line drying offers a chemical-free alternative that protects both personal health and ecological balance.

Opting for line drying means avoiding the release of these chemicals into the air and water systems. Dryer sheets, in particular, shed microfibers and chemicals during use, contributing to water pollution and potentially harming aquatic life. Fabric softeners, often rinsed down drains, introduce synthetic compounds into wastewater treatment systems, many of which are not fully removed before discharge into natural water bodies.

Consider the cumulative impact: a single load of laundry using dryer sheets can release hundreds of microfibers and chemical residues. Multiply that by millions of households, and the environmental toll becomes staggering. Line drying circumvents this issue entirely, offering a zero-chemical solution that safeguards water quality and reduces the burden on treatment facilities.

For those concerned about stiffness in line-dried fabrics, natural alternatives exist. A half-cup of white vinegar added to the rinse cycle acts as a chemical-free softener, neutralizing residues without leaving behind synthetic fragrances or coatings. Wool dryer balls, another eco-friendly option, physically soften fabrics by reducing static and friction, eliminating the need for disposable sheets altogether.

Lower Carbon Footprint: Decreases reliance on fossil fuels for electricity generation

Line drying clothes is a simple yet powerful way to reduce your carbon footprint. Every time you opt for a clothesline over a dryer, you directly cut down on electricity consumption. In the U.S., dryers account for approximately 6% of a household’s annual electricity usage, according to the U.S. Department of Energy. By eliminating this demand, you lessen the strain on power grids that often rely on fossil fuels like coal and natural gas for electricity generation. This small shift in habit translates to fewer greenhouse gas emissions and a tangible contribution to combating climate change.

Consider the broader impact: if just 10% of American households line-dried their clothes year-round, the collective energy savings could power over 100,000 homes annually. This isn’t merely theoretical—countries like Italy and Spain, where line drying is culturally ingrained, demonstrate significantly lower per-capita energy use for laundry compared to the U.S. The math is clear: fewer kilowatt-hours used means less reliance on fossil fuels, which are the largest source of global carbon emissions.

For those concerned about practicality, line drying doesn’t require a drastic lifestyle overhaul. Start small: air-dry towels, jeans, and bedding, which consume the most energy in a dryer cycle. Invest in a retractable clothesline or drying rack for indoor use during inclement weather. Even partial adoption makes a difference—reducing dryer use by half still cuts your laundry-related emissions significantly. Pair this with washing clothes in cold water, and you’ll amplify your environmental impact without sacrificing cleanliness.

Critics might argue that line drying isn’t feasible in all climates or living situations. However, creativity and adaptability can overcome these barriers. Apartment dwellers can use portable drying racks near windows or on balconies. In humid regions, timing laundry to drier parts of the day or using a fan to circulate air can speed up drying. Water Conservation: Indirectly supports water savings by reducing energy-intensive laundry processes

Line drying clothes might seem like a small, old-fashioned habit, but its impact on water conservation is far from trivial. Traditional laundry processes, particularly those involving tumble dryers, are energy-intensive. According to the U.S. Department of Energy, dryers account for about 6% of a household’s annual electricity consumption. This energy demand often stems from non-renewable sources, which indirectly strain water resources through the extraction, processing, and cooling of fossil fuels. By opting for line drying, you bypass this energy-heavy step, reducing the overall water footprint associated with your laundry routine.

Consider the lifecycle of energy production: coal-fired power plants, for instance, require approximately 20–50 gallons of water per kilowatt-hour to generate electricity. A single dryer cycle can consume 2–5 kWh, translating to 40–250 gallons of water used indirectly for drying clothes. Multiply this by the average 300 loads of laundry a household does annually, and the water savings from line drying become staggering. Even in regions with renewable energy, reducing electricity demand eases pressure on water-intensive cooling systems for power plants.

Practical implementation of line drying requires minimal effort but yields significant results. Start by investing in a sturdy outdoor clothesline or a foldable indoor drying rack. For outdoor drying, choose a sunny, breezy spot to speed up the process. If space is limited, consider retractable lines or over-the-door hangers. Heavy items like towels or jeans can be rotated halfway through to ensure even drying. Pair this with cold-water washing cycles, which save up to 90% of the energy used in heating water, to maximize your water conservation efforts.

Critics might argue that line drying is time-consuming or weather-dependent, but these challenges are surmountable. On rainy days, use a portable indoor rack near a heater or fan. For those in humid climates, wring clothes gently before hanging to reduce drying time. Modern innovations like umbrella-style lines or ceiling-mounted pulleys offer space-efficient solutions. By embracing these adaptations, households can cut their laundry-related water footprint by up to 30%, contributing to broader conservation goals without sacrificing convenience.
